Enugu’s laudable education budget & Abia’s recurrent spending

In 2015, the United Nations Educational, Scientific, and Cultural Organisation, UNESCO, Member States agreed on a minimum educational funding benchmark of 4 to 6 per cent of the GDP, or 15 to 20 per cent of public expenditure. This is in recognition of the place of human capital development in the overall development of any nation. Unfortunately, […]

Yuletide: Sen Abiru distributes over 8,500 food packs to vulnerable

By Olasunkanmi Akoni Senator Adetokunbo Abiru, representing Lagos East Senatorial District, has distributed over 8,500 food packs to his constituents for the Christmas and New Year celebrations. The packs, containing rice, beans, and garri, were simultaneously distributed across the 16 Local Governments/Local Council Development Areas of the Senatorial District. The initiative targeted vulnerable groups within […]
